A calm, practical, and collaborative approach

Therapy, for me, is a space for slowing things down and making sense of what feels heavy, confusing, or stuck — without judgement or pressure to have it all figured out.

I see people as more than a diagnosis or a set of difficulties. Alongside struggle, there are often real strengths, quiet resilience, guiding values, and ways of coping that have carried you through — even when those ways no longer quite fit your life.

I bring curiosity to how your experiences have come together, and what might become possible when we begin to understand them differently.

My style balances insight with practical strategies. Together we work to understand why patterns developed while building skills that help create lasting change.
